Lady Killer by Lisa Scottoline

This is the first time that I've read Lisa Scottoline. I thought it was a good read. The story is about Mary Dinunzio who is an attorney at Rosato & Associates. Her clients are mostly from her home neighborhood in South Philly. Trish Gambone, her high school rival, comes in for her help. She is terrified of her live-in boyfriend, who was tutored by Mary while they were in high school. The boyfriend is part of the mob now. Then Trish vanishes, a dead body turns up in an alley, and Mary is plunged into a nightmare, one that threaten her job, her family, and even her life. The story will keep you reading. I will read more of her books. Pat M
